atcoder#ABC250A. [ABC250A] Adjacent Squares

[ABC250A] Adjacent Squares

配点 : 100100

問題文

HH 行、横 WW 列のマス目があり、このうち上から ii 個目、左から jj 個目のマスを (i,j)(i,j) と呼びます。 このとき、マス (R,C)(R,C) に辺で隣接するマスの個数を求めてください。

ただし、ある 22 つのマス (a,b),(c,d)(a,b),(c,d) が辺で隣接するとは、 ac+bd=1|a-c|+|b-d|=1 (x|x|xx の絶対値とする) であることを言います。

制約

  • 入力は全て整数
  • 1RH101 \le R \le H \le 10
  • 1CW101 \le C \le W \le 10

入力

入力は以下の形式で標準入力から与えられる。

HH WW

RR CC

出力

答えを整数として出力せよ。

3 4
2 2
4

入出力例 1,2,31,2,3 に対する説明は、出力例 33 の下にまとめて示します。

3 4
1 3
3
3 4
3 4
2

H=3,W=4H=3,W=4 のとき、マス目は以下のようになります。

  • 入力例 11 について、マス (2,2)(2,2) に隣接するマスは 44 つです。
  • 入力例 22 について、マス (1,3)(1,3) に隣接するマスは 33 つです。
  • 入力例 33 について、マス (3,4)(3,4) に隣接するマスは 22 つです。

1 10
1 5
2
8 1
8 1
1
1 1
1 1
0